Finally, I should point out that this is a perfect example of how decks in Tales of Middle-earth should definitely be looking to splash: both the UW and RW decks will be significantly improved by adding a couple of key uncommons from the third color. In particular, I think adding an aggressive Humans payoff like Erkenbrand can do wonders for the UW deck, but I wouldnt say no to extra flyers in RW either
